Abstract
[Problem] To provide a sealing device having high pressure-resistance and durability for a reciprocating shaft. [Solution] A sealing device comprising an oil seal member and a dust seal member. The oil seal member and the dust seal member each comprise a rigid ring provided inside a shaft hole and an elastic ring attached to the rigid ring, wherein the elastic ring has formed thereon a lip for slidably contacting a reciprocating shaft. The sealing device further comprises an intermediate rigid ring provided between the elastic ring of the oil seal member and the elastic ring of the dust seal member, in a direction parallel to the axial direction of the reciprocating shaft.
